Scottish National Rhododendron Show at Garelochhead
Scottish National Rhododendron Show at Garelochhead
Nipped over to Garelochhead which is about 30 minutes drive from Appletree Cottage to visit the #Scottish National Rhododendron Show at the Gibson Hall in the village
Picture
The beautifully restored Gibson Hall hosted this year's Scottish Rhododendron Society Show
Inside the beautifully restored Gibson Hall all manner and types of rhododendron flowers were on display having been judged by experts
Scottish National Rhododendron Show at Garelochhead
Stalls outside the Scottish Rhododendron Show
Outside the hall in glorious sunshine people were selling plants  (mostly rhododendrons!)
from makeshift stalls.  The event although small appeared to be enormously popular.
A really nick trip across to Gareloch in the sunshine.

Blossom Time at Appletree Cottage and Shandon Farm

2/5/2019

1 Comment

 

Apple Orchard begins to bloom

Beauty of Moray
Beauty of Moray - pink blossom and green apples
Its the beginning of May and our apple trees at Shandon Farm and Appletree Cottage are well underway with their blossom.  Festoons of pink and white flowers are starting to appear on many trees
Beauty of Moray apple treeBeauty of Moray - one of our most rewarding varieties
Di

Different varietis of tree flower at different times.  Orchardists need to take this into account when considering cross pollination.
Discovery apple tree
Discovery variety has white blossom and red apples
Some trees have white flowers (eg Discovery) and others pink (eg. James Grieve and Beauty of Moray)  If the flower is successfully pollinated by insects a small bulge appears on the flower stem immediately behind the flower head.  This with luck will develop into an apple
James Grieve apple tree
James Grieve apple blossom - apples are red and yellow
We started planting apple trees at Shandon Farm in 2014 and now have over 360 trees and 46 varieties.  Fingers crossed for a fruitful summer!
